"AMERICA'S NEXT TOP MODEL," Robin Manning
Age: 26 years old
Height/Weight: 5'9 / 160 lbs
Hair/Eyes: Brown hair / Brown eyes
Hometown: Memphis, Tenn.
Education: Masters degree from Tennessee State University
Self-Description: Determined, ambitious, fun and looking for a God-fearing man who will treat her like a queen.
Background: She has competed in beauty pageants and has been a model for church fashion shows. She was once crowned "Miss Soybean." She is single and has one sister. Her hero is Oprah Winfrey because of her generosity, skill as a businesswoman and example of the true of fame and fortune.
Favorite Things: TV shows: "The Best Damn Sports Show Period" and football; Music: Gospel, R & B, Pop and Country; Food: chitterings; Supermodel: Iman.
Other Activities: Playing basketball.
Life Motto: quote from the bible: "I can do all things through Jesus Christ who strengthens me."
The Interview
Robin Manning was our least favorite model on America's Next Top Model. We didn't care for her preaching, bible-reading ways. She was just a touch too holier-than-thou. So interviewing her was a bit surreal. She was very much the southern lady (I could have done without being called ma'am) and spun the tale of her personality in an expert way. If you hadn't watched the show you would almost love her. But...... I had been watching the show. Love wasn't quite the emotion I was feeling.
When I flat out asked her about her seeming "Preachy, snotty, stubborn and bitchy at times", Robin quickly responded with "That's called good editing." Robin explained that they pretty much became a character. It was a character based on their true personalities, but blown up. Does she reads the bible all of the time? "Yes. But do I do other things, too? Yes."
Ahh - maybe I'd get her on the vanity question. If vanity is a sin, why model? Isn't that a contradiction? "If you're a model it doesn't mean that you think you're 'all that'. You don't perceive yourself as the best. A Supermodel can be humble. It's a chance to travel the world and learn things." Mmm hmmm. Still seems like a vain career if you ask me.
Robin hadn't modeled professionally before. She had done a few fashion shows, etc. A friend talked her into trying for the show as a favor to him. As one of the chosen finalists, she moved into the house with the intention of becoming a role model for woman of all sizes, shapes and colors. Yep - this size 6 (sometimes an 8) chick is considered a Plus Size model. That thought alone is enough to make me sick. She's a size 6! Yowza! Something is a bit screwed up in the modeling world - but that is another rant.......
The entire experience was more than Robin had hoped for. She does admit that if she had known there would be nudity she wouldn't have done it. But overall the experience was more than she had expected. "There was more hands-on experience. I learned a lot." She has no regrets and wouldn't change anything. Although the trip to Paris wasn't the greatest time. It isn't what she wants to be remembered for. But hey - those were great episodes! Of course we're going to remember those.
Reality vs. Real life. No, Elyse and Adrienne didn't hate the bible-thumpers according to Robin. She also went on to say how funny Adrienne was, and how she liked living with all of the girls. "It wasn't as catty as you would think. There was no time to be catty."
Robin most enjoyed working with the acting coach, and hopes to work more in the acting field. She isn't sure if she'll pursue modeling. "I'll see what comes my way." As for who will win? "I pray Miss Shannon wins. She is really sweet and deserves it. But Lord has his reasons for whoever wins."
Oh Lord.
~June 2003
